Low cost Air Asia now fly daily to Yangon

Here’s another cheaper way to fly to Burma!

Air Asia, Asia’s largest low-cost carrier is now flying Bangkok-Yangon-Bangkok on a daily basis. Flight details are:

Bangkok-Yangon   FD# 3770 (0715/0800)
Yangon-Bangkok   FD# 3771 (0835/1020)

The airfare including taxes and service fees is approximately US$ 85.00 per person roundtrip.

30 Days visa on arrival Laos now available!

As of August 2006, the visa on arrival Laos are now available for period of stay up to 30 days (from 14 days). It is also available at any port of entry to Laos. Visa fee is US$ 30.00 per person. For those of you who would like to stay longer, visa extension is available (it is cheapest in Vientiane) at US$ 1.00 per person per day. If you arrange for visa extension through travel agents or tour companies, they will normally charge you up to US$ 4.00 per person per day (including their handling charge).
